This being the sequel to Tom Mabe's album "Revenge on the Telemarketers: Round One", he does mostly the same stuff in this album as he did in the previous one. Random telemarketers call him, and he puts on a big act trying to act as crazy as possible. Generally he has a pre-scripted act ready for them, as he confuses the telemarketers or at least puts them in uncomfortable positions. This is most evident when he makes it known that he's talking to the telemarketer while sitting on the toilet with the exclamation "Oh my god. I just pooped a J."

The CD is a fun way to spend an hour or so, but the jokes get a bit old after 3 or 4 runs through the CD. This CD would be good on a road trip to help pass the time.
